Project approved

HAFIZABAD
A sewerage and drainage scheme costing Rs162 million has been approved in the Annual Development Programme for improving longstanding sewerage and drainage problems in the eastern part of the city, said a meeting.
The project includes both the sides of Gujranwala Road from Jinnah Chowk to General Bus Stand, it added. Presided over by DCO Mansoor Qadir, the meeting was attended among others by Saeed Bhutta Executive Engineer Public Health Engineering Department, MPA Malik Fayyaz Ahmad Awan, Ex-MPA Haji Jamshaid Abbas Thaheem, ex-district nazim Malik Ali Ahmad Awan and District Officer (Cord) Noman Hafeez. The DCO said that the Punjab government had released Rs20 million as first installment for implementing the project. He also directed an executive engineer to start the project at the earliest after getting necessary approval by the provincial government.
